Delaying early consensus: ArcticSwarm hits 82.6% on BrowseComp-Plus with gated agent isolation
rohanpaul_ai · x · 2026-09-08
The arXiv paper ArcticSwarm tackles a key failure mode in long-horizon multi-agent research: when agents share partial findings too early, one plausible answer attracts all the search effort before alternatives are tested.
Key design:
- Separating evidence gathering from integration: subagents publish to a shared bulletin board instead of syncing in real time
- Gated isolation: selected search tasks keep their own prior, blocking premature consensus
- Structured review at three commitment boundaries: only confident candidates propagate
Results: 82.6% on the full BrowseComp-Plus with open-weight Qwen 3.5-27B (78.8% without gated isolation, 74.5% without structured review, vs. MiroFlow baseline at 70.6%). On live-web BrowseComp with GPT-5 it reaches 73.6%, well above the reported provider system (54.9%) and MiroFlow (63.4%).
